Transaction 724eada1010cfb6b29c9d758ceac6b9d5953a82d651e319f69ec8c8d353ea559

1 Input
1 Outputs
  • 724eada1010cfb6b29c9d758ceac6b9d5953a82d651e319f69ec8c8d353ea559:0
  • value  2584432
    address  3CCycwhCamqveee6GG12edga5MnDub3TmU